Here's some screenshots to hopefully make it a bit more clear. The top item in
the menu is the cause - its "abcdefghijklmnopqrstuvwxyz" with a <wbr> stuck in
the middle. Firefox has implemented <wbr> and the word breaks in two. We
don't, but it's not really that big of an issue, just a bit of chopped off
text.
The issue is that it causes an extra line break to be added to the container -
the blank space between the last item in the list and the bottom border you can
see through. This doesn't happen in Safari 2.0.4 or Firefox.
